4 girls gang-raped in Punjab:1 dead 2 critical

 Four women, between the ages of 13 and 25, were reported gang raped on in the last 48 hours One of them died at a hospital and two more are in critical condition.  The police have arrested three suspects and are still looking for 11 more.

City Circle DSP Nasruallah Waraich said arfa*, a resident Rehmanabad of Sheikhupura district had been befriended by Faisal Ali, a resident of Dera Ghazi Khan.

He said Ali had been working as a daily wage worker when they met a year ago.

He said Ali had asked her to elope and marry him.

He said the girl left home a week ago and went to meet him in Dera Ghazi Khan.

The DSP said Ali took her to a house and introduced her to two of his friends, Hafiz Kamal Anwar and Muhammad Shahid. He said the girl was tied up and raped.

The DSP said on Friday night when the girl lost consciousness after the incessant abuse , Ali took her to a hospital and told doctors that she was his wife.

He said the doctor treating the girl soon realised from the extent of her horrific injuries that she had been viciously assulted and subsequently the police was called. He said

The DSP said the men had been arrested and had confessed. He said the girl later died. Rape was confirmed in her medical report, he added.

Separately, a 13-year-old girl was assaulted by some men in Bahawalpur.

Hussain Akram, a resident of Chak 126P told Manthaar police that his 13-year-old daughter was abducted by Arshad and an unidentified man when she was returning from school.

Akram said they took her to a deserted house and tied her up.

He said that on resistance they beat her mercilessly and then gang raped her multiple times.

Afterwords, the men brought her back home and threw her out of the car at the entrance.

He said the girl was taken to a hospital where doctors said she was in a critical condition.

Manthaar police have registered a case Akram’s complaint and started search for the suspects.

In another incident, two women were gang raped in separate incidents near Tandlianwala police station.

Muhammad Arshad told newsmen that his 15-year-old niece was alone at home when seven men broke into their house. He said the men took her away on gun point and tried to rape her. He said when she resisted, the men beat her unconcious.

He said when she fainted, they raped her as she lay defenseless.. He said they then dropped her near her house and fled.

He said he took his niece to a hospital where doctors treating her said her condition was serious. The police have registered a complaint against one Yaseen and six unidentified men.

Separately, some unidentified men three men broke into the house of a 25-year-old woman and assaulted her. Police said when the woman started screaming, the men fled.

A police spokesman said her medical report was awaited.

* Names have been changed to protect identities.
